Looks like 4A Girls District 7.......Argyle, Decatur, Krum, and Bridgeport......all 4 district qualifiers for the playoffs made it to this Regional Quarterfinal Round coming up. Argyle(34-0) and ranked #1 in every poll will play Bridgeport(24-10).  Bridgeport was the 4th place team in District 7.  Meanwhile......Decatur(32-5) will play Krum(26-10).  Decatur qualified as the Runner-up slot in District 7 while Krum qualified in the 3rd spot.  Not sure how many times this has happened at any classification in either Boys or Girls Basketball Playoffs......but it can only happen at this Regional Quarterfinals Round.  All 4 teams are so good that ANY of the 4 teams could win in these two matches.  Naturally the Argyle Lady Eagles and Decatur Lady Eagles are both favored, but Bridgeport and Krum are very capable and very good.  I saw where the Gilmer Girls won their District 15 and Paris qualified in the 4th spot.  These two District 15 foes will  meet in the Regional Quarterfinal Round this week also.  That in itself is unusual......for a W team to meet the F team out of the same district in this round.

You have to figure in that all three teams......Decatur, Krum, and Bridgeport......each team had two of their losses to Argyle in District 7 play.  Otherwise, their records would be even better.  Decatur lost 2 games in District 7(to Argyle), while Bridgeport and Krum both lost 5 of their games in District 7......they tied  with the same district standing at 7-5.  Argyle and Decatur won both games against Bridgeport and Krum......and then Brigdeport and Krum split their two games with each other.....hence 5 losses in district for them.  Castleberry, Lake Worth, and Springtown had no chance whatsoever in this district, for sure.  But Lake Worth is good this season in Boys Basketball.

Here is one more oddity......over in Region 3, the winner of District 19 was Burnet(17-12), while the fourth place team was Lake Belton(22-10).  I don't know how Burnet at (17-12) won that district and then won the first two rounds to get to this Quarterfinal Round, and I really don't know how Lake Belton got 4th place in that district.  But here are both of these two district foes meeting in this Quarterfinal Round.  Upsets do occur, but now we are in Round 3 of the playoffs......so normally you have district winners vs district winners or district runner-ups in this round.

Argyle Ladies defeat Bridgeport 60-36 to go (35-0) and advance to the Regional Semis in Lubbock.  They will play the winner of the Canyon/Levelland game Tues. night.  

Decatur defeated Krum in a tightly contested game 37-34 to go (33-5) on the season, and will face Seminole(25-4) who won BIG against Big Spring 85-12.

Looks like both Argyle and Decatur will have their hands full in the Region 1 Semifinals against those West Texas powers. Region 1 looks very strong in 4A Girls Basketball again this season.  Whichever team survives to come out of Region 1 will be very tough to beat in the State Tournament.
